波浪滑翔器是一种新型自主海洋观测平台,能在不同海况下对海洋环境持续观测;介绍了其总体结构、运动机理,并与其他观测方式进行了对比,指出了波浪滑翔器的观测优势和应用领域;同时对总体参数进行了初步研究,给出了波浪滑翔器长宽及挂缆长度等的设计依据,并对其在不同海况下的运动性能进行了预估.
Principle and System Design of a Wave Glider
The wave glider is a new autonomous surface platform with unique capabilities for persistent observation in a variety of marine environments. This article introduces its system configuration and motion mechanics, compares itself with other observation platforms, and draws out its much advantages as well as application areas. Then, a preliminary research into the system parameters is made and design basis of the width and umbilical length of the glider is given as well as the prediction of the navigation performance of the glider within different sea conditions.
